body {  font-family: Arial, Helvetica, sans-serif; background-color: #FFFFFF}

.cellule_tableau_bleu { font-family: Arial, Helvetica, sans-serif; font-size: 9px; background-color: #006bb6; color: #cdddee; font-weight: bold }
.cellule_tableau_bleu_recherche { font-family: Arial, Helvetica, sans-serif; font-size: 9px; background-color: #006bb6; color: #FFFFEE; font-weight: bold }
.cellule_tableau_bleu2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; background-color: #006bb6; color: #FFFFFF; font-weight: bold }
.cellule_tableau_orange_pâle {  font-family: Arial, Helvetica, sans-serif; background-color: #FFF0CC}
.cellule_orange {  background-color: #B9D300; font-family: Arial, Helvetica, sans-serif}
.cellule_bleu_foncé {  font-family: Arial, Helvetica, sans-serif; background-color: #004777}
.cellule_blanche {  font-family: Arial, Helvetica, sans-serif; background-color: #FFFFFF}

.champ_texte {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#004777}
.champ {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old; color: #113377; background-color: #c3ddee}

.recherche {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7ems; color: #FFFFEE; background-color: #006BB6}

.fond_menu_recherche { background-color: #006BB6; padding-left: 8px; font-family: Arial, Helvetica, sans-serif; color: #C3DDEE ; font-size: 0.8em }
.fond_menu_recherche { background-color: #006BB6; padding-left: 8px; font-family: Arial, Helvetica, sans-serif; color: #C3DDEE ; font-size: 0.8em }
.fond_menu_bas { background-color: #006BB6; padding-left: 8px; font-family: Arial, Helvetica, sans-serif; color: #C3DDEE ; font-size: 0.8em }

.fond_gp {  background-color: #e23828; font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; color: #ffffee; font-weight: bold}
.fond_gp_clair {  background-color: #f3afa9}
.fond_prof {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; font-weight: bold; color: #FFFFEE; background-color: #FFB400}
.fond_prof_clair {  background-color: #ffe199}
.fond_titulaires {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; font-weight: bold; color: #FFFFEE; background-color: #B9D300}
.fond_titulaires_clair {  background-color: #E3ED99}
.fond_reseau {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; font-weight: bold; color: #ffffee; background-color: #a91bb0}
.fond_reseau_clair {  background-color: #D5A7D6}
.fond_presse { font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; font-weight: bold; color: #ffffee; background-color: #00bab9}
.fond_presse_clair { background-color: #99e3e3}
.actus {  background-color: #006BB6}


a.nav:link,a.nav:visited {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; color: #FFFFEE; text-decoration: none }
a.nav:hover, a.nav:active {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em; color: #FFFFEE; text-decoration: underline}

a.menu:link, a.menu:visited , a.menu:active  {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em;color: #FFFFFF; text-decoration:none;}
a.menu:hover  {  font-family: Arial, Helvetica, sans-serif; font-size: 0.8em;color: #004773; text-decoration:none;}

/*lien bleu*/
a.lienbleu:link {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; color: #004777; font-weight: normal; text-decoration: underline }
a.lienbleu:hover {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; color: #0075c4; text-decoration: underline; text-align: left; vertical-align: baseline; font-weight: normal}
a.lienbleu:visited {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; }

/*lien blanc*/
a.lienblanc:link {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; color: #FFFFEE; font-weight: normal; text-decoration: none}
a.lienblanc:hover {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; color: #FFFFEE; text-decoration: underline; text-align: left; vertical-align: baseline; font-weight: normal}
a.lienblanc:visited {  font-family: Arial, Helvetica, sans-serif; font-size: 0.7em; color: #FFFFEE; font-weight: normal }
.bandeau_haut {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#FFFFEE; font-style: normal; font-weight: bold; text-align: right}

/*bandeauhautlien*/
a.bandeauhautlien:link {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#004777; font-weight: normal; text-decoration: none}
a.bandeauhautlien:hover {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#004777; text-decoration: underline; font-weight: normal}
a.bandeauhautlien:visited {  font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#004777; font-weight: normal}
